Greek-Melkite Metropolitan Archdiocese of

Aleppo

Syria Syria

Continent: Central and Southwest Asia

Rite: Greek-Melkite (Byzantine)

Type: Metropolitan Archdiocese

Population: 18,000 Catholics (2011)

Statistics: 12 parishes, 1 mission, 21 priests (20 diocesan, 1 religious), 1 deacon, 29 lay religious (1 brother, 28 sisters), 4 seminarians (2011)

Suffragan Sees: no suffragan sees

Neighbouring Dioceses: Latakia (↙), Damascus (↘), Homs (↓)

Depends on: Congregation for the Oriental Churches
